Christopher Shannon launches new line
Dec 10, 2015
Christopher Shannon, the Liverpudlian designer who launched his menswear brand in 2008, has launched a new label, North Quarter.

The collection aims to join the dots between the creativity seen on the catwalk and aspirational quality-led menswear, and to take Shannon's vision of technical sportswear to a new customer.
“Inspired by my catwalk collection, North Quarter takes influences, design markers and key silhouettes from the Christopher Shannon mainline and repackages them for a detail-obsessed male customer brought up on a diet of premium technical sportswear brands. North Quarter gives me the opportunity to speak directly with the brand-led British males who have inspired me creatively since the outset of my career,” said North Quarter creative director, Christopher Shannon.
The label launches for A/W16 with 50 styles available at wholesale. They include jackets, knits, sweats, over-shirts, shirts and jog pants, with the focus on tech-led fabrics. Prices have yet to be confirmed.
